Ahoy

Pronunciation: /əˈhɔɪ/

Ahoy (interjection)

  1. A friendly call used to greet or get attention on a boat.
  2. Used to get someone's attention, especially from a distance.

Examples

  • Ahoy, welcome aboard the ship!
  • The captain shouted 'Ahoy!' to greet the crew.
